Tech deal aiming to keep track of target markets

- By Tom Patterson echo,news@jpimedia.co.uk @sunderland­echo

A fast-growing outdoor advertisin­g business is tapping into real-time traffic data, after signing an exclusive deal with a global data business.

Houghton based Smart Outdoor - which has a network of 300 screens across the UK-is now in partnershi­p with tech business Data Jam, which will allow it to counts the number of passers-by at any given time.

The ‘Jam Boxes’ fitted to the firm’s screens enable the Smart Outdoor to more accurately count the audience in real-time – helping customers understand the true reach of their adverts and create more targeted campaigns.

Smart Outdoors – part of the Smart Media Group – is utilising the technology across a number of its large digital screens, including those at The Tyne Tunnel.

Mark Catterall, chief executive, said: “This is a brilliant partnershi­p that represents a truly unique opportunit­y to understand the actual impact of the campaigns we deliver for clients.

“The ethos of all Smart Media Group businesses is to use accurate data to help us deliver the best possible value for money for our clients, and innovation such as this will achieve just that."

He added: “We're proud to have struck up a relationsh­ip with a hugely innovative global firm that will allow us to demonstrat­e to clients the return on investment for their campaigns, and we look forward to building on the early success of this partnershi­p throughout 2022.”

This is the first time Data Jam’s Jam Boxes have been used in this way.

Arran Javed, founder of Data Jam, said: “We are excited to be working with such a forward-thinking company to give them and their clients a better understand­ing of the true numbers."

Mr Catterall added: “This really does build on our commitment to being the smartest possible provider of outdoor advertisin­g, giving our customers rich data and insight that allows them to achieve the greatest possible advantage from their campaigns.”

Smart Outdoor, which is based at The Evolve Centre at Rainton Bridge, is one of five companies that are either fully or part-owned by Mr Catterall. The group also includes Smart Media, Smart Vision, Smart Communicat­ions and Smart Sanitiser
